Canvas引擎是一个功能强大的工具,用于在网页上创建动态和交互性的图形。它为开发人员提供了灵活的绘图功能,可以通过JavaScript代码控制和操作图形元素。本文将介绍几个常用的Canvas引擎,并提供相应的源代码示例。
- Three.js:精美3D渲染
Three.js是一个流行的JavaScript库,提供了创建和渲染3D图形的功能。它建立在WebGL技术之上,并简化了使用WebGL的复杂性。下面是一个简单的示例,展示如何在Canvas上绘制一个旋转的立方体:
<!DOCTYPE html>
<html>
<head
本文介绍了Canvas引擎在创建网页动态图形和交互性方面的应用,重点讨论了Three.js、Pixi.js和CreateJS这三个流行的JavaScript库。Three.js用于3D渲染,Pixi.js专注于高性能的2D渲染,而CreateJS则是一个全面的HTML5游戏开发引擎。通过实例代码展示了如何在Canvas上实现交互式的图形效果。
订阅专栏 解锁全文
543





